DECISION & ORDER ON MOTION

Appeal from an order and judgment (one paper) of the Supreme Court, Queens County, dated September 20, 2018. By order to show cause dated December 17, 2019, the parties to the appeal were directed to show cause before this Court why the appeal in the above-entitled action should or should not be dismissed for failure to comply with a decision and order on motion of this Court dated October 10, 2019.

Now, upon the order to show cause and the papers filed in response thereto, it is

ORDERED that the motion is granted, and the appeal is dismissed, without costs or disbursements.
